Heavy rainfall is not the only reason for flooding. Inner concerns like burst pipes and also overflows can lead to emergency flooding. Sadly, this will also cause damage to your property. Failure to deal with the issue will certainly rise the damages and also increase the chances of mold growth. Keep on reviewing to learn what you can when managing emergency situation flooding.
1. Turn Off Key Water Valve
Pipelines can rupture due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, blockage, hot water heater issues, as well as various other factors. Regardless of the reason, you should act swiftly to ensure permeable home materials, home appliances, and also home furnishings do not absorb the water, leading to damages. Shut down the major valve before you do any cleansing to make certain water stops pouring in. Killing the water source is easy, as well as it is something you can do yourself. As for the burst pipe, call for emergency plumbing services to repair it immediately.
2. Shut Off the Breaker
With a huge flood, you require to ensure the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can cause injuries or deaths. Turn off the circuit breaker to avoid electrocution. If you can not do it, make a quick call to the power business to shut the key line.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.
3. Relocate Important Damp Times
When it concerns conserving your furnishings and devices, time is of the essence. You must relocate whatever whet items you can from the affected area to a dry location. This discourages more damage since the longer they soak in water, the much more comprehensive the problem.
4. Record the Level of Damage
Take note of all the damage brought upon by the burst pipe. With documents, you can likewise obtain a clear picture of the level of the damages.
5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P
You should get rid of excess water as soon as feasible. Must there be a big amount of standing water, you may require a water pump for removal. When very little water is left, you can soak up the remainder with old tee sh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Area
You can also set up electrical fans as well as put them in the toughest setup. A dehumidifier also functions in taking out moisture to protect against mildew and also molds.
7. Collaborate with Professionals
When you experience substantial water damages because of emergency situation fl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can deal with a reconstruction professional to reconstruct and also restore your home. Above all, don't fail to remember to call a trusted plumbing professional to repair the burst pipe and check the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will be rendered useless.

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ations
If you reside in a storm-prone area, you should be made use of now on what to do, where to go and also what to have to be prepared for negative climate. Nevertheless, if you're not used to obtaining pounded by high winds and tough rain, you possibly do not have an idea just how best to encounter a storm scenario.
For starters, tornados do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ations keep track of the ambience day in and day out. If a storm is feasible, they will provide 2 sorts of warnings:
Storm watch-- is issued when there is a possible tornado in your location.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, cloudy sky, an unusually gusty day and also some rain. The storm may or may not come, but this is the time to keep tuned to your local radio for news and updates.
Tornado warning-- is issued when a tornado is headed toward your location. By that time, the streets can be flooded and website traffic is poor. You do not want to be captured in your automobile in bad weather condition.
Snowstorm-- typically takes place in winter season and also implies hefty snow, solid winds and wind cool. When a caution is issued, prevent taking a trip as much as feasible and also stay inside your home. There is no usage revealing yourself outdoors where you could get caught in website traffic or in areas where you will be difficult to reach or worse, discover.
Things do not constantly go poor during storms, yet climate is unforeseeable and anything can take place. To assist you prepare for a storm emergency situation, right here are a few pointers:
Dress up.
Put on sufficient clothes to maintain yourself cozy. Heat might not be offered in your house so obtain extra layers and coverings to maintain your body temperature level sufficiently.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ots all set.
Have food ready.
Emergency situation provisions are a must throughout tornado emergency situations. If the storm gets too bad and also the roads are swamped,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ery stores.
Maintain bottles of water handy. Tidy water might be hard to come by throughout truly bad problems as well as the most awful thing you can do is suffer from d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every single person daily that will last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ing as well as pur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have kids in your house, take safety measures by covering deep containers and also keeping kids far from the bathroom unless required.
Emergency situation package
Have a medical or first set prepared and also make sure it's freshly-stocked. It ought to include an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also essential medications. It's additionally a excellent suggestion to have an additional package in your automobile.
If any individual in your household is under unique medicine, ensure you have enough supplies to last until after the tornado mores than as well as drug shops are open.
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ions during tornado emergency situations. You won't have any electricity, so supply on candles,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ries and also suits in case you run out.
If you can not switch on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your location. Media will keep an eye on the storm as well as will keep you upgraded.
You might require hot water during the duration when power is not yet available, so maintain a tiny tank of gas about just in case. Your outside barbecue grill will do well.
Obtain an alternative shelter.
Make certain you have adequate gas in your storage tank in situation you need to obtain out of the residence as well as relocation someplace. Keep to a greater ground where you have much better chances of being secure and also completely dry.
